Snake oil - don't waste your money. Claiming that the mod will work for RX-7 and RX-8, while these models have different engines and different ECUs should've tipped you off... The ad isn't even consistent. It says that it is a "timing advance resistor mod", but then claims that the mod fools the ECU into thinking that the intake air is cold. Two completely different things.

I wouldn't bother. The only thing that this will do for sure is remove about $15 from your wallet (including shipping). It is highly unlikely that this will give you any performance gains in my opinion. It looks like it consists of a $0.10 resistor that takes the place of a sensor. If it is indeed taking the place of the intake air-temperature sensor, all it will do is mess up the air/fuel ratio.

People have used these on LS1s for a while and to no avail. You unplug your air intake sensor from the wire it connects to and plug the resistor into it. Then plug the wire to the back of the resistor. In effect it's supposed to adjust your A/F ratio to more lean conditions making more power. All I saw was cars running to lean which is a great way to cook somthing important. They made more power for a little bit, but not worth scorched pistons (rotors in your case). A little better would be proper tuning IMHO.
